Exhibition of creative works by Kyrgyzstan students held at Zhubanov university

Today, as part of the academic mobility program, Zhubanov University hosted an art exhibition by students from the Kyrgyz State Technical University named after I. Razzakov. The event showcased the creative works of young Kyrgyz designers, each demonstrating a unique artistic style.

The exhibition featured graphic and applied arts, architectural projects, avant-garde fashion collections, handcrafted works in macrame technique, as well as individual student projects. Each piece stood out for its creative innovation, artistic uniqueness, and conceptual depth.

As part of the event, Ainura Dzholdosheva, a specially invited guest and professor from the Kyrgyz State Technical University, Candidate of Technical Sciences and Associate Professor, delivered a speech. She emphasized the importance of scientific and creative collaboration between universities.

The professor noted that the main goal of the exhibition was to showcase modern trends in architecture and design, create opportunities for the exchange of creative ideas between students and faculty, and to further develop and strengthen international academic cooperation.
